hot fun in the summertime.

While creating a mixtape of music for driving, there should always be music with harmonies (the Roches), classic rock (the Rolling Stones), songs that make you wriggle-dance in your seat (M.I.A), songs you used to listen to all the time and identify with emotionally (The Beatles), eighties hair metal (Guns 'N Roses).... It should be feel-good, feel-bad, heartbroken, and ecstatic. So that the drive is literally and figuratively a journey (don't forget Don't Stop Believin'). And it makes the final destination all the more beautiful.
